The Anthem claim dispute form with email in Kings is a vital tool for resolving disputes between creditors and debtors. This form enables users to formally agree on the settlement of a disputed claim, detailing the terms of the agreement and the specific claims involved. It includes sections for identifying the creditor and debtor, the amount to be paid, a description of the claim, and the debtor's denial of the claims. Users should ensure all fields are completed accurately, and the document must be signed in the presence of witnesses to be valid. This form serves as an effective means for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ants to facilitate dispute resolution efficiently. It's designed to simplify the negotiation process and provides a clear record of the agreement reached. Timely filing is when an insurance company put a time limit on claim submission. For example, if a insurance company has a 90-day timely filing limit that means you need to submit a claim within 90 days of the date of service.

Anthem will consider reimbursement for the initial claim, when received and accepted within timely filing requirements, in compliance with federal, and/or state mandates. Anthem follows the standard of: • 90 days for participating providers and facilities. 15 months for nonparticipating providers and facilities.
